区块链贫血现象,如何保障去中心化应用中的数据完整性与可用性?

区块链贫血现象,如何保障去中心化应用中的数据完整性与可用性?

在区块链技术的广泛应用中,我们时常会遇到一个被称为“贫血”的挑战,这并非指区块链本身“贫血”,而是指在去中心化应用(DApps)中,由于数据存储和访问的特殊性,导致某些关键数据或功能在特定情况下无法被有效访问或使用。

在DApp中,如果某个节点或服务器出现故障,而该节点恰好存储了关键数据或执行了某些关键功能,那么整个DApp的可用性将受到严重影响,这就像一个庞大的网络系统突然“贫血”,无法正常运作。

为了解决这一问题,我们可以采取以下策略:

1、数据冗余与分布式存储:通过在多个节点上存储数据副本,确保即使部分节点出现故障,数据仍可被其他节点访问和使用。

2、智能合约的容错设计:在编写智能合约时,应考虑多种异常情况,并设计相应的容错机制,确保即使某些功能暂时无法使用,DApp的整体运行也不会受阻。

3、定期维护与备份:对DApp进行定期的维护和备份,确保关键数据和功能的持续可用性。

通过这些措施,我们可以有效缓解“区块链贫血”现象,保障去中心化应用中的数据完整性与可用性,推动区块链技术的健康发展。

相关阅读

发表评论

  • 匿名用户  发表于 2025-04-22 15:19 回复

    区块链贫血现象挑战数据完整性,多层次验证与智能合约保障去中心化应用的稳定可用性。

添加新评论